Mailing Lists: Apple Mailing Lists

Image of Mac OS face in stamp
 
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: Shark time profile finds no symbols



James Walker wrote:
When time profiling a certain app with Shark 4.5 and OS 10.4.11 on a MacBook Pro, the profile shows only 4 numerical addresses, plus io_alltraps in the kernel. The numerical addresses show a hint saying that "Shark was unable to find symbol information for this address range. Typically this happens because the application was compiled without symbols or they have been stripped away..." But there definitely are debug symbols; this debug build is 3 times the size of the release build. I had originally tried DWARF, but switched to STABS. I might have some frameworks without symbols, but still I should see the top level symbols, like say "main", right?

This machine does not have Xcode installed on it, just CHUD, is that a problem?

To follow up on my question, if I profile a more normal operation of the app, the app symbols do show up. It's only when I attempt to profile this particular hang (apparently in OpenGL) that I see no app symbols.


And to answer my second question, I installed Xcode 2.5 and reinstalled CHUD 4.5, and there was no improvement.
--
James W. Walker, Innoventive Software LLC
<http://www.frameforge3d.com/>
_______________________________________________
Do not post admin requests to the list. They will be ignored.
PerfOptimization-dev mailing list (email@hidden)
Help/Unsubscribe/Update your Subscription:
http://lists.apple.com/mailman/options/perfoptimization-dev/email@hidden


This email sent to email@hidden
References: 
 >Shark time profile finds no symbols (From: James Walker <email@hidden>)



Visit the Apple Store online or at retail locations.
1-800-MY-APPLE

Contact Apple | Terms of Use | Privacy Policy

Copyright © 2007 Apple Inc. All rights reserved.